To our registered participants, we offer the two payment options: a) Wire Transfer or b) Card Payment.
a) Wire Transfers
For wire transfers, OUR payment instruction must be selected (meaning the sender accepts all foreign transaction fees). Payments made using the SHA (Shared) or BEN (Beneficiary) option will be considered invalid.
VAT is included in the conference fee.
b) Card Payments
For card payments, participants will be charged a one-time registration fee at the time of payment. Conference fees in EUR, as listed on the ISD 2025 website, are charged in Serbian currency RSD (Serbian dinar), based on the official exchange rate of the National Bank of Serbia. The amount charged to the participant’s credit or debit card is obtained through the conversion of EUR fee into RSD. The following payment cards are supported: VISA, MasterCard (EC/MC), Maestro, American Express (Amex), and Dina.
When charging the credit card, the amount charged in RSD is then converted into the currency supported by the participantās card using the exchange rate applied by participant’s card issuer or payment network. As a result of currency conversion, there is a possibility of a slight difference between the final amount charged and the price displayed in EUR on the ISD website.
VAT is included in the conference fee.
An additional charge of ā¬15 will be applied on the top of the registration amount due to the bank processing costs.
Please note that the final amount may be subject to additional fees or conversion charges imposed by the participantās bank or payment provider, and it is beyond our responsibility.
The organizers have made every effort to offer flexible and convenient payment methods that best serve all conference participants. We kindly ask for the understanding of international participants, as payment in RSD (Serbian dinar) is the most practical and efficient option for all parties.
In both payment options, apart from the charges being listed here, no additional hidden charges apply.
